Title: IMPROVED TASK CONTROL BLOCK STRUCTURE
|
|
||||||
Description: All task resources that are shared amongst threads have
|
|
||||||
their own "break-away", reference-counted structure. The
|
|
||||||
Task Control Block (TCB) of each thread holds a reference
|
|
||||||
to each breakaway structure (see include/nuttx/sched.h).
|
|
||||||
It would be more efficent to have one reference counted
|
|
||||||
structure that holds all of the shared resources.
|
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
These are the current shared structures:
|
|
||||||
- Environment varaibles (struct environ_s)
|
|
||||||
- PIC data space and address environments (struct dspace_s)
|
|
||||||
- File descriptors (struct filelist)
|
|
||||||
- FILE streams (struct streamlist)
|
|
||||||
- Sockets (struct socketlist)
|
|
||||||
Status: Open
|
|
||||||
Priority: Low. This is an enhancement. It would slight reduce
|
|
||||||
memory usage but would also increase coupling. These
|
|
||||||
resources are nicely modular now.
